**Mgmt Meeting Minutes — Retiring the Brightline Range**

Quick recap for sales leads at Fenholt Supplies: we agreed to retire the Brightline fixture range by year-end. Remaining stock moves to clearance pricing next month, and accounts on standing orders get migrated to the Lumetta range. Trade-in incentives were approved in principle. The confidential note on next steps sits just below.

board note of bajof-bajeg: The pricing group signed off on a budget of $13.4 million for Project Sildor. The renewal with Lamixek Holdings closes at $48.9 million a year, 49 percent above the last contract.

**Handover — Pylonware OTA Channel (Mira → contractor)**

Firmware pushes go through the staged channel only. Canary ring first, 24h soak, then fleet. Rollback image lives in slot B; never flash over it. Signing runs on the build box, not your laptop. Channel config is sealed; if you need to edit rollout percentages, unseal it with the passphrase below.

vault phrase of kawep-tahog = ulaix-briath

## Runbook — Chalkline Solver Stalls

If a timetable run exceeds 20 minutes, check the constraint queue depth first. Kill runs only after confirming no checkpoint is in progress. Restarting mid-solve loses partial placements. Before restarting, verify the worker is using the current production settings, shown here.

service settings:
[casax]
port = 6379
team = rusir
host = casax.zemvarhq.corp
region = outer-4
access_code = ac_9808ce
timeout_ms = 1500

Handover note — Crumbwheel order cutoffs.

Welcome aboard. The bakery cutoff rule in Crumbwheel closes same-day orders at 14:00 local to each storefront, not UTC — this has bitten us twice. Holiday overrides live in the calendar service and take precedence silently, so always check there first when a cutoff looks wrong. To unlock the calendar service's admin console after a restart, enter the recovery passphrase below.

vault phrase of bagap-bahaf = silion-pelox-sorox-casdor-quenwyn-fraax-eliox-praael-kelion-quenvan-kasox-rusael-norius-belvan